Grant Aviation is an Alaskan regional air carrier serving rural Alaska since 1971. With bases in Bethel, Emmonak, Dillingham, King Salmon, Cold Bay, Dutch Harbor, Kenai, and Anchorage, Grant Aviation provides scheduled air transport of passengers, cargo, and mail, as well as air ambulance and charter service. Grant employs approximately 400 people.

Position: Flight Standards Manager

Join our team at Grant Aviation as a Flight Standards Manager, where you'll play a vital role in ensuring the standardization of all flight policies and procedures in accordance with applicable regulations. Reporting directly to the Director of Operations, you'll oversee the development and maintenance of our flight standards to uphold our commitment to safety, reliability, and professionalism.

Your responsibilities will include creating, reviewing, and revising an advanced qualification program to align with regulatory requirements and industry best practices. You'll develop and implement advanced qualification programs, supervise and train ground and flight instructor personnel, and coordinate with key stakeholders to ensure consistency in our pilot training programs.

As a Flight Standards Manager, you'll enforce departmental safety objectives, liaise with regulatory authorities, and serve as a company flight instructor and check airman as required. You'll work closely with the Director of Operations, Chief Pilot, Assistant Chief Pilot, Flight Training Manager, LMS Manager, and Pilot Records Clerk to maintain compliance and uphold our high standards of excellence.

We're looking for candidates with a Bachelor's Degree, a Commercial Pilot Certificate with an Instrument Rating, and experience in Part 135 or 121 operations. Strong communication, organizational, and project management skills are essential, along with proficiency in Microsoft Office. The ability to work independently and as part of a team, along with flexibility and adaptability, are also key attributes we're seeking.
